Our client is an award-winning technology company developing enterprise software used by organisations across the UK and internationally.
They are looking for five high-calibre STEM graduates to join their Technical Engineering team.
This is fundamentally a technical support and problem-solving role, working with complex enterprise software and live customer environments.
But it is also a starting point.
You'll build an understanding of the technology, products, customers and systems that can open future career paths into areas including Software Development, Data Science, Product Management and Project Management.
What You'll Be Doing
Working alongside experienced technical teams, you'll:
Investigate and resolve technical issues across enterprise software platforms
Diagnose faults and identify the root cause of problems
Analyse system behaviour, performance and technical data
Support cloud-based applications and business-critical systems
Work with Engineering and Development teams to resolve more complex issues
Communicate clearly with both technical and non-technical users
Document issues, solutions and technical findings
Develop a detailed understanding of how enterprise software works in the real world
This isn't scripted helpdesk support.
You'll be expected to think, investigate, question and solve problems.
